DOOR REMOVAL
tfdoor must be removed to fit through narrow doorways;
I. Gently lay freezer on its back, on a throw rug or
blanket.
2. Remove the base panel by unscrewing two screws
from front of base panel, Remove wire from clips, on
bottom of cabinet. (Figure 1)
3, Unplug connector by holding the cabinet connector in
place, and pulling door connector out. (Figure 1)
4, At the top of the cabinet, fift up plastic hinge cover, and
fold back. (Figure 2)
54 Use a Phi!lips_ screwdriver to loosen and retighten
the screws on the top hinge to insure a secure
assembly, and prevent hinge slippage.
6. Remove the top hinge from cabinet, and {ift door off
lower hinge pin+
7. After door is removed, remove the two screws from the
bottom hinge.
8. To re _lacedoor, reverse above order.

The freezer should be located in the coolest area of the
room, away from heat producing appliances or heating
ducts, and out of direct sunlight.
Let hot foods cool to room temperature before placing in
the freezer_Overloading the freezer forces the compres-
sor to run longer. Foods that freeze too slowly may lose
quality or spoil
Be sure to wrap foods properly, and wipe containers dry
before placing them in the freezer. This cuts down on
frost build-up inside the freezer.
Freezer shelves should not be lined with aluminum foi!,
wax paper, or paper toweling Liners interfere with cold
air circulation, making the freezer less efficienL
Organize and label food to reduce door openings and
extended searches. Remove as many items as needed
at one time, and dose the door as soon as possible.
COOL DOWN PERIOD
For safe food storage, allow 4 hours for the freezer to
cool down completely° The freezer will run continuously
for the first several hours. Foods that are already frozen
may be placed in the freezer after the first few hours of
operation. Unfrozen foods should NOT be loaded into
the freezer until the freezer has operated for 4 hours.
When loading the freezer, freeze only 3 pounds of
fresh food per cubtc foot of freezer space at one time.
Distribute packages to be frozen evenly throughout the
freezer+,It is not necessary to turn the control knob to a
colder setting while freezing food,,
TEMPERATURE CONTROL
The temperature control is located inside the freezer. The
temperature control should be factory pre-set to number 4,
which will provide satisfactory food storage temperatures.
However,the temperature control is adjustable to provide a
range of temperatures for your personal satisfaction. If a
colder temperature is desired, turn the temperature control
knob to a higher number,, Adjust by one numerical increment
at a time, and allow several hours for temperatures to
stabilize between adjustments.
